Output 58e106160f6eb18e43e3c1fa9377871b2e86e8a2383c3131de364f03e786d2f9:1
- value
- 35495508
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 69162b7aab7d65ebad16243b69d068fec63c7481 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1AaeWXiyhdna1h45zjUxuLNYCRp8LQruua
- transaction
- 58e106160f6eb18e43e3c1fa9377871b2e86e8a2383c3131de364f03e786d2f9